Néstor Camacho

Visual Artist and Digital Creator
Born in Bogotá, Colombia (1985), Lives and Works in Bogotá

Achievements:

  • Winner of Best VJ at Don’t Stop the Party Festival (2015), Bogotá.
  • Featured at Rock al Parque, one of the largest music festivals in Latin America, as part of his work as a VJ.
  • Exhibited at ARTBO and the Museo de Arte Contemporáneo in Bogotá, showcasing his visual and digital artistry.
  • Active contributor to large-scale audiovisual performances and visual compositions for cultural events across Colombia.

Néstor Camacho is a multidisciplinary visual artist and digital creator whose work bridges traditional and digital mediums. Based in Bogotá, his art spans video mapping, audiovisual production, painting, and urban interventions, exploring themes of labour, social behaviour, and the dichotomy between formal and informal work. His approach often incorporates techniques like collage and motion, blending diverse textures and visuals to create immersive experiences.

Since 2010, Camacho has delved into digital creation, utilising software like TouchDesigner and Blender to explore new media. He has gained recognition as a VJ, performing in major events such as Rock al Parque and collaborating with both local and international musicians and DJs. His audiovisual works challenge viewers with their complex narratives, combining glitch art with vibrant urban landscapes.
